Dog on Death Row Asks for Pardon


An unusual inmate has asked the governor of Florida for clemency says the Sun Sentinel. Brandie, an 11-year-old Huskie, was sentenced to death row after an altercation with another dog on the street. A new local law mandates that animals be euthanized after they are involved in an attack on city property. The woman who organized the appeal says she got the idea from a time-honored tradition: “The president pardons the turkeys on Thanksgiving, so I figured it can’t hurt to ask!’‘
